On architectures without a DMI (basically all architectures except x86),
attempting to install nvme-cli >= 1.14-1 results in:

Setting up nvme-cli (1.16-2) ...
"gen-hostnqn" not supported. Install lib uuid and rebuild.
dpkg: error processing package nvme-cli (--configure):
 installed nvme-cli package post-installation script subprocess returned
error exit status 161

This is because 1.14 refactored gen-hostnqn to try searching the DMI for
a unique ID, but will fall back to a randomly generated UUID, but only
if libuuid is available at build time.

Adding uuid-dev to Build-Depends will fix this issue.
